国产户外一区二区三区在线_亚洲欧美日韩九九_亚洲一区在线观看黄色性中文字幕_大波福利等你来国产福利在线观看6080_黄色三级片91视频_中美日韩亚洲高清_欧美性暴力变态影院_中文字幕不卡一二三区高清_国产成人在线播放视_人妻系列无码区久久精品

溫州網(wǎng)站建設服務商
JSP與ASP,PHP之間去區(qū)別
發(fā)表時間:2018.11.27  來源:管理員  類別:技術文檔


ASP
ASP 釆用腳本語言 VBScript(JavaScript)作為自己的開發(fā)語言。ASP 是 Microsoft 開發(fā)的動態(tài)網(wǎng)頁語言,也繼承了微軟產(chǎn)品的一貫傳統(tǒng),只能在微軟的服務器產(chǎn)品 IIS(Internet Information Server)上執(zhí)行。

ASP 是 Web 服務器端的開發(fā)環(huán)境,可以產(chǎn)生和執(zhí)行動態(tài)的、交互的、局效的 Web 服務應用程序。 其技術特點主要有以下幾個方面:
與瀏覽器無關(Browser Independence),客戶端只要使用可執(zhí)行 HTML 碼的瀏覽器,即可瀏覽 Active Server Pages 所設計的網(wǎng)頁內容。Active Server Pages 所使用的腳本語言(VBScript、JScript)均在 Web 服務器端執(zhí)行,客戶端的瀏覽器不需要執(zhí)行這些腳本語言。
Active Server Pages 能與任何 ActiveX Scripting 語言兼容。除了可使用 VBScript 或 JScript 語言設計外,還可以通過 plug-in 方式,使用由第三方提供的其他腳本語言,如 REXX、Perl、Tel 等。腳本引擎是處理腳本程序的 COM(Component Object Model)對象。
使用 VBScript、JScript 等簡單易懂的腳本語言,結合 HTML 代碼,即可快速地編寫出網(wǎng)站的應用程序??墒褂梅掌鞫说哪_本來產(chǎn)生客戶端的腳本。

使用普通的文本編輯器,如 Windows 的記事本,即可進行程序設計,無須編譯,容易編寫,可在服務器端直接執(zhí)行。


PHP
PHP 是跨平臺的服務器端的嵌入式腳本語言。它幾乎都要借用 C、Java 和 Perl 語言的語法,同時結合 PHP 自己的特性,使得 Web 開發(fā)者能夠快速地寫出動態(tài)頁面。PHP 的特點是:支持絕大多數(shù)數(shù)據(jù)庫,并且其源碼是完全公開的。

PHP 可在 Windows、Unix、Linux 的 Web 服務器上正常執(zhí)行,還支持 IIS、Apache 等一般的 Web 服務器,用戶更換平臺時,無需變換 PHP 代碼。

PHP 與 MySQL 是目前絕佳的組合。用戶還可以自己編寫外圍的函數(shù)間接存取數(shù)據(jù)庫,通過這樣的途徑,在更換使用的數(shù)據(jù)庫時,可以輕松地修改編碼以適應 這樣的變化。
提示:

PHP LIB 就是最常用的可以提供一般事務需要的一系列基庫。但 PHP 提供的數(shù)據(jù)庫接口支持彼此不夠統(tǒng)一。


JSP
JSP 同 PHP 類似,幾乎可以在所有平臺上執(zhí)行,如 Windows、Linux、Unix。Web 服務器 Apache 已經(jīng)能夠支持 JSP,而 Apache 廣泛應用在 Windows、Unix 和 Linux 上,因此 JSP 有更廣泛的執(zhí)行平臺。

雖然現(xiàn)在 Windows 操作系統(tǒng)占了很大的市場份額,但是在服務器方面 Unix 的優(yōu)勢仍然很大,而新崛起的 Linux 更是來勢不小。

從一個平臺移植到另外一個平臺時,JSP 和 JavaBean 甚至不用重新編譯,因為 Java 字節(jié)碼都是標準的,與平臺無關。 ASP、PHP、JSP 三者都是面向 Web 服務器的技術,客戶端瀏覽器不需要任何附加的軟件支持。

普通的 HTML 頁面只依賴于 Web 服務器,但 ASP、PHP、JSP 頁面需要附加的語言引擎分析和執(zhí)行程序代碼。程序代碼的執(zhí)行結果被重新嵌入 HTML 代碼中,然后一起發(fā)送給瀏覽器。 三者都提供了在 HTML 代碼中混合某種程序代碼、由語言引擎解釋執(zhí)行程序代碼的能力。JSP 代碼被編譯成 Servlet 并由 Java 虛擬機解釋執(zhí)行,這種編譯操作僅在對 JSP 頁面的第一次請求時發(fā)生。

在 ASP、PHP、JSP 環(huán)境下,HTML 代碼主要負責描述信息的顯示樣式,而程序代碼則用來描述處理邏輯。

copyright ? 2011 - 溫州龍誠互聯(lián)科技有限公司 73804.cn 版權所有 翻版必究

龍誠互聯(lián) - 溫州網(wǎng)站建設服務商 溫州app開發(fā)服務商

工信部備案號(浙ICP備11044124號-3)